On Wed, 1 Dec 1999 14:37:01 +0100, "Zeth Johansson" <zeth.johansson_at_ifsab.se> wrote:

>Hi Brian!
>
>I've had the same problem with Oracle 7.3.4 on HP-UX. When I had two
>different ORACLE_SIDs with the same first three characters, e g SID1 and
>SID2, Oracle couldn't tell which was which. When I renamed SID2 to 2SID, it
>worked fine. I haven't talked to Oracle support about it, but my own
>conclusion is that multiple ORACLE_SIDs with the same first three characters
>aren't allowed.
>

We have currently two databases (4 before) all with the format 3 characters+1 unique letter e.g. abc1 abc2 abc3 and have had no problem as yet (iin development on out production machine we have just one database).
